I hope you might have an idea what causes this behavior. And maybe you have a suggestion how to prevent it. Furthermore, I guess the behavior might be interesting for you to note/observe (but that is just a guess). On Fri, 24 Feb 2023 at 21:29, Eli Zaretskii wrote: > > From: dalanicolai > > Date: Fri, 24 Feb 2023 21:26:05 +0100 > > Cc: emacs-devel@gnu.org > > > > I have not really looked at it yet, but just as a quick thought: > > I am not sure if/why I should debug an infloop, because the functionality > > works perfectly fine when not showing the margins (i.e. when just > setting > > the window margins to nil). So it seems to me its not about an infinite > loop. > > > > I was saying 'more or less' because it does not really hang, it just > takes > > extremely long to update the buffer text. When waiting long enough, > > then it seems to continue. > > > > Of course, I don't want to waste your time, but I think my instructions > > for reproducing the error, are very clear and short this time (i.e. take > less > > than/about a minute). I think it would be most informative if you > reproduce the > > error there. > > What should I do after I reproduce it, though? What are your > expectations from me (or whoever else tries your recipe)? >